Champaign County Veteran’s Assistance Commission will meet on July 16.

Here are the agenda provided by the commission:

1. Call to order

2. Pledge of Allegiance

3. Roll Call

4. Introduction of the Guest and First-Time Attendees

5. Approval of Minutes

      A. May 2025

6. Approval of Agenda

7. Public Comments

8. Superintendent’s Report

9. Treasures Report

10. Unfinished Business

      A. Consider and take action, and approve the Fiscal Year 2025 Budget

      B. Bi-Law review, consider, and take action to approve language adding a Treasurer description and role to the Bi-Laws.

       C. Search for a Secretary for the Veterans Administrative Board

11. New Business

      C. Consider and take action to approve the budget for fiscal year 2025 for the VAC

      D. Consider and take action to approve a Superintendent pay increase By 10% which is $3.00 or 20 % which is $ 6.00

      E. Consider and take action to hire an Administrative Assistant it was approved by the prior board and we don’t wont to lose the position.

12. Good of the Commission

13. Next Meeting Date

      A. September 16, 2025

13. Salute the Flag

14. Adjournment
